使用cli搜索神器存储库时遇到以下错误的人?有时会出现以下错误(大约1次失败,3次成功)。有什么想法吗?
g Artifactory.
[Info:] Searching Artifactory using AQL query: items.find({"repo": "NONPROD_RPM","$or": [{"$and": [{"path": {"$match":"*"},"name":{"$match":"*"}}]}]}).include("name","repo","path","actual_md5","actual_sha1","size")
[Error:] Post ssh://artifactory.xyz.com:1339/api/search/aql: unsupported protocol scheme "ssh"
[Error:] Post ssh://artifactory.xyz.com:1339/api/search/aql: unsupported protocol scheme "ssh"
答案 0 :(得分:0)
您的配置文件出现问题。很可能你的jfrog-cli.conf文件中的ssh-key-path不存在或不正确。 请尝试重命名您的jfrog-cli.conf文件。
mv ~/.jfrog/jfrog-cli.conf ~/.jfrog/jfrog-cli.conf.old
/opt/jfrog/jfrog rt config --url ssh://artifactory.xyz.com:1339/ --ssh-key-path /user/<latomaster>/.ssh/id_rsa